I have a basically stock 96 Z28 A4 which currently has 2.73 gears. (The only *mods* my car has is a KN Filter & Hyp. Power Programmer+) What kind of performance difference would I see swithing to a 3.42 ratio? Has anyone else reading this ever took a stock LT1 and went from 2.73 to them? What was the difference, and how much less gas mileage. Thanks in advance for any tips!

Yes, 3.42s are a very good compromise gear. You'll probably see a small loss in mpg, but nothing big, that is if you keep the same driving habits.
Here's a little math for you to compare:
Engine to Wheel Drive ratios(1st gear):
M6 w/ 3.73s= 9.92
M6 w/ 4.11s= 10.93
A4 w/ 3.42s= 10.47
A4 w/ 3.73s= 11.41
I think you'd be very happy with the 3.42s. I know there's a lot of old guys that say they ran 4.11s on their 69 Camaro with no overdrive, but then again they probably didn't drive for hours on the expressway at 80 mph either.
